The ticket office at Ascot (Berks) station operates throughout the week, ensuring you can purchase or collect your tickets with ease. It opens early, from 6 AM on weekdays, and provides services on weekends as well. You’ll find ticket machines in place, equipped to handle purchases with Disabled Persons Railcard discounts for added accessibility.
Additionally, the station offers smartcard issuing and validation, providing a seamless experience for regular travelers. While luggage storage is not provided, CCTV cameras ensure security across the station. Travelers will be pleased to find accessible facilities, including a heated waiting room on Platform 3 and available seating areas, while accessible toilets are stationed on Platform 1.
Ascot (Berks) station is designed to be accessible, offering step-free access to Platform 1, with lifts available for other platforms. The station ensures comfort and ease for all passengers, including those with impairments, by providing accessible ticket machines, induction loops, and staff assistance. While there are no accessible taxis or designated pick-up/drop-off points, customers can expect warm and accommodating service from station staff.

At Marske Station, you'll find the essentials for a smooth rail experience, albeit with limited facilities. The station lacks a ticket office, but rest assured, ticket machines are available for ticket collection if purchased online. However, these machines are not accessible for those with disabilities, so plan accordingly. The station offers step-free access, ensuring wheelchair users and those with mobility impairments can navigate with ease.
For safety, CCTV is present around the station. Although staff help isn't available on-site, assistance can be requested upon arrival or in advance through the Passenger Assist service. If waiting's on the agenda, note that there are no waiting rooms or seating areas—but there's no harm in bringing a travel cushion for just-in-case comfort!
When it comes to extending your journey beyond Marske Station, the travel options are diverse. For bus travel, a nearby stop makes hopping on to explore local sites straightforward. If the trains are temporarily on pause and a rail replacement service is necessary, make your way to High Street at the station's top approach. For those relying on taxis, Northern Railway's Cab4You service offers an accessible solution. Cyclists would need to plan ahead, as bicycle hire isn't available at the station.
